• This is the 250th issue of FVNews. We started in April 2020 with just six listings. This issue carries 387 listings.
• Freemasons Victoria election results. Total eligible voters, 6945. Total voted, 1493 (21.5 per cent). Masonic Council elected: John Rodrigo, Pete Grounds, Robert Woolley, Eric Williams, Dominic Donato. Commercial Council elected: Felix Pintado, Trevor Somerville, Chris Dzanovski.
• Votes. Masonic Council: Pete Grounds, 861, Robert Woolley, 850; Jack Aquilina, 770; Ronan Jachiomowicz, 647; Norman Wittingslow, 447; Eric Williams, 837; John Rodrigo, 924; Dominic Donato, 815; William Lodge, 732; Jonathan Ivanyi, 582. Commercial Council: Felix Pintado, 1121; Hendrikus van Ravanstein, 461; Trevor Somerville, 950; Chris Dzanovski, 675; Joseph Farrah, 648; Richard Skinner, 594.

• Jared Shaw writes: WBro. Lord Baden-Powell was promoted to Grand Lodge Above on July 3 after a short illness. He was Past Master of Baden-Powell Lodge No 488 (UGLV) an honorary member of numerous lodges worldwide including Lodge Amalthea 914 (UGLV), Lodge Unity Peace and Concord 316 (EC).
